Hotel Premier Inn Colchester (Cowdray Avenue)
3 StarsCowdray Avenue--Colchester, Colchester, United Kingdom - CO1 1UT - Colchester, United Kingdom View Map
Cowdray Avenue--Colchester, Colchester, United Kingdom - CO1 1UT - Colchester, United Kingdom View Map